Mrs. Margaret M. Broussard v. Sam A. Distefano, Sr., Superintendent of Schools of Iberville Parish, 492 F.2d 135, 1974 U.S. App. LEXIS 9310 (5th Cir. 1974).
Opinion
The decision of the District Court is VACATED and the cause remanded for reconsideration under Cleveland Board of Education v. LaFleur, 414 U.S. 632, 94 S.Ct. 791, 39 L.Ed.2d 52 (1974). Costs are taxed against the appellees.
